We want to thank Jin-shan and Xue-bin for bringing up important questions regarding the clinical perspective of tumor necrosis factor receptor-associated factor 2 (TRAF2) signaling in the heart. First, our study identified TRAF2 as a critical prosurvival factor by suppressing apoptosis and necroptosis in cardiomyocytes;1 both forms of programmed cell death are critically involved in the pathogenesis of myocardial infarction and chronic heart failure.2 We showed that ablation of TRAF2 predisposed the heart to pathological remodeling and heart failure by promoting death receptor (eg, TNFR1)-mediated apoptosis and necroptosis signaling.1 Tumor necrosis …
